This matchweek is headlined by a top 4 clash between Tottenham and Liverpool, with Spurs having the pleasure of hosting, coming off an encouraging draw against their North London rivals. Meanwhile, on Monday, we get a West London derby, with Chelsea trying to get back into the top half of the table. We also have a potential relegation six pointer at Goodison Park, when newly-promoted Luton Town visit the Toffees.
